Cagliari offers a fantastic mix of history, architecture, and stunning views, all packed into a city that’s perfect for exploring on foot or by comfortable vehicle. Its narrow streets in the old town reveal centuries of stories, while panoramic outlooks from hills like Monte Urpinu provide memorable photo opportunities. 2. Cagliari City Tour – Minivan Sightseeing and Walking

Cagliari City Tour - Minivan Sightseeing and Walking

At number 2 is the Cagliari City Tour – Minivan Sightseeing and Walking, which boasts a perfect 5-star rating from 20 reviews. For about $106, you’ll enjoy a comfortable, comprehensive experience that combines the convenience of air-conditioned transport with short walks at key landmarks. The tour lasts roughly 3 to 4 hours, making it a great choice for travelers who prefer a broader overview without too much walking.

The tour kicks off with spectacular views from Monte Urpinu, where you’ll see the city from a 10-minute viewpoint. Then, you’ll visit the Roman Amphitheatre, Sardinia’s most important ancient site, and stroll through the Old King’s Palace—a stunning example of historic architecture. If time permits, you can also explore the Museo Archeologico di Cagliari and enjoy a relaxing walk in Parco Naturale Molentargius-Saline, famous for its birdlife, especially flamingos.
